Output 4123645239efd72cffccaa11d8981c861f3218561341f0859d6c9079e1c8394e:1

value
27121683
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f15c9ab3d38f255f1507001515b0eaf97e33c33 OP_EQUAL
address
3LZyu6NRKNvoVAFRFMum8t9qY2Vi6CjAgf
transaction
4123645239efd72cffccaa11d8981c861f3218561341f0859d6c9079e1c8394e
spent
true